Option Greeks Exposure

Exposure

The concept of Option Greeks Exposure, within cryptocurrency derivatives, quantifies the sensitivity of an options portfolio’s value to changes in underlying asset price, volatility, time, and other pertinent factors. It represents the aggregate risk arising from the combined effect of Delta, Gamma, Vega, Theta, and Rho across all options held, providing a holistic view of potential losses or gains. Effective management of this exposure is paramount for traders and institutions seeking to mitigate risk and optimize returns in the volatile crypto market environment, demanding sophisticated hedging strategies and continuous monitoring. Understanding and actively controlling Option Greeks Exposure is crucial for navigating the complexities of perpetual futures, European-style options, and other crypto-based derivatives.
